How to Use This Tool

Start by entering your body weight in either pounds or kilograms. Weight matters because moving a heavier body requires more energy, even for the same amount of ax work. Next, enter how long you spent actually chopping — not the whole time you were outside. If you paused to stack wood, catch your breath, or carry logs, only count the active minutes. The quick-fill buttons make 15-, 30-, 60-, and 90-minute sessions one tap away.

Choose an effort level that honestly matches your session. "Moderate" describes steady splitting of typical firewood with normal rest stops; "Vigorous" is for heavy logs, a fast rhythm, or almost continuous work. The calculator then shows two numbers: total calories burned and a fat-equivalent estimate. Both are useful for planning meals, comparing activities, or tracking a weekly chore routine.

How the Calculation Works

This estimate uses metabolic equivalents (METs), a standard way to express the energy cost of a task relative to rest. Sitting quietly is roughly 1 MET; moderate chopping is about 4.8 METs, meaning your body is burning nearly five times more energy per minute than at rest. The formula is:

Calories burned = MET × 3.5 × body weight (kg) ÷ 200 × time (minutes)

The 3.5 represents standard oxygen consumption at rest (3.5 mL/kg/min), and dividing by 200 converts that into kilocalories per kilogram per minute. This is the same framework used by most fitness calculators and activity-tracking studies.

To translate calories into an approximate fat mass, we use the common energy density of body fat: 7,700 kcal per kg, or about 3,500 kcal per pound. Dividing the calorie total by 7.7 gives grams of fat tissue. Note that this is a planning figure, not a precise measurement. During exercise your body burns a mix of carbohydrate and fat, and the exact ratio depends on intensity, diet, and fitness level. Over weeks, however, consistent calorie deficits do approximate this conversion. For the underlying activity values, the Compendium of Physical Activities is the standard reference.

Worked Examples

Example 1 — 70 kg, moderate, 30 minutes. Using MET 4.8: 4.8 × 3.5 × 70 ÷ 200 × 30 = 176 kcal. Fat equivalent: 176 ÷ 7.7 ≈ 23 g. That's roughly the energy in a small apple plus a slice of bread — a modest but real contribution to a calorie deficit.

Example 2 — 85 kg, vigorous, 45 minutes. Using MET 6.3: 6.3 × 3.5 × 85 ÷ 200 × 45 = 421 kcal. Fat equivalent: 421 ÷ 7.7 ≈ 55 g. Chop four times a month and the planning-equivalent fat mass reaches about 220 g, or roughly half a pound.

Intensity & MET Reference

Effort LevelTypical DescriptionMET Used
LightEasy splitting of small or softwood pieces, relaxed rhythm3.5
ModerateSteady splitting of standard firewood, natural rest pauses4.8
VigorousHeavy or wet logs, fast pace, little rest, plus hauling6.3

Research values for chopping wood range from about 3 to 7 METs depending on load and pace. The choices above are reasonable midpoints. If your session includes a lot of walking to a wood pile, treat the calories as slightly lower; if you are also dragging large logs, nudge the intensity upward.

Frequently Asked Questions

Can I target belly fat by chopping wood? No. Spot reduction is a myth. Chopping burns calories and builds upper-body endurance, but where fat leaves first is largely determined by genetics. A consistent calorie deficit is the only reliable way to reduce overall body fat.

Why is my fitness watch showing a different number? Wrist-worn devices estimate heart-rate-based calories and often add resting energy or exaggerate arm movement. The MET calculation is a research-backed average for the activity itself; the difference is normal.

How many calories does one hour of chopping burn? For a 70 kg adult, moderate chopping yields about 353 kcal per hour (4.8 × 3.5 × 70 ÷ 200 × 60 ≈ 353). Vigorous chopping at 6.3 METs would be about 463 kcal per hour for the same person.
